Are you passionate about pushing the boundaries of AI at the intersection of the digital and physical worlds? Join our Cosmos research team to develop generative models that bridge virtual and physical realms. You will have access to massive computational resources and work on problems that move research into real-world systems.
Responsibilities
- Pioneer revolutionary generative AI algorithms for physical AI applications, with a focus on advanced video generative models and video-language models.
- Architect and implement sophisticated data processing pipelines that produce high-quality training data for Generative AI and Physical AI systems.
- Design and develop physics simulation algorithms that enhance Physical AI training.
- Scale and optimize large-scale training systems to efficiently harness the power of 20,000+ GPUs for training foundation models.
- Author research papers and share discoveries with the global AI community.
- Collaborate closely with research teams, internal product groups, and external researchers to drive innovation.
- Facilitate technology transfer and contribute to open-source initiatives.
Requirements
- PhD in Computer Science, Computer Engineering, Electrical Engineering, or a related field (or equivalent experience).
- Deep expertise in PyTorch and related libraries for Generative AI and Physical AI development.
- Strong foundation in diffusion models, vision-language and reasoning models and their applications.
- Proven experience with reinforcement learning algorithms and implementations.
- Robust knowledge of physics simulation and its integration with AI systems.
- Demonstrated proficiency in 3D generative models and their applications.
Ways to Stand Out
- Publications or contributions to major AI conferences (ICLR, NeurIPS, ICML, CVPR, ECCV, SIGGRAPH, ICCV, etc.).
- Experience with large-scale distributed training systems.
- Background in robotics or physical systems.
- Open-source contributions to prominent AI projects.
- History of successful research-to-product transitions.
